diff options
author | Claudio Jeker <claudio@cvs.openbsd.org> | 2021-11-09 11:00:44 +0000 |
---|---|---|
committer | Claudio Jeker <claudio@cvs.openbsd.org> | 2021-11-09 11:00:44 +0000 |
commit | 6bf4aa97efa0af044f603cf98fc8aca07461a785 (patch) | |
tree | 27324cd5e5865b173d7ee0333d244157cfced143 /usr.sbin/rbootd | |
parent | 77cd0e23b2769d0f5bd9876d052b487e7e7096f8 (diff) |
Implementation of HTTP Keep-Alive sessions introduced a regression for
the HTTP redirect limit. The loop counter is reset during the redirect
because a new http request is allocated in http_redirect(). Pass the
current redirect_loop count to http_req_new() thereby the count
increases for every redirect.
With and OK benno@ job@ tb@ beck@ deraadt@
Diffstat (limited to 'usr.sbin/rbootd')
0 files changed, 0 insertions, 0 deletions